Retinol; Retinyl Acetate; Retinyl Palmitate

(2E,4E,6E,8E)-3,7-dimethyl-9-(2,6,6-trimethylcyclohexen-1-yl)nona-2,4,6,8-tetraen-1-ol; [(2E,4E,6E,8E)-3,7-dimethyl-9-(2,6,6-trimethylcyclohexen-1-yl)nona-2,4,6,8-tetraenyl] acetate; [(2E,4E,6E,8E)-3,7-dimethyl-9-(2,6…

For any cosmetic product containing Retinol, Retinyl Acetate or Retinyl Palmitate the following, labelling is obligatory: ‘Contains Vitamin A. Consider your daily intake before use’.

EINECS (EC 200-001-8 to 299-999-9 and 300-000-5 to 399-999-0 range) covers substances on the EU market before 18 September 1981. ELINCS covers substances notified after that date. NLP (No Longer Polymers) covers substances that lost polymer status. All three use the EC number format and are referenced in EU cosmetics annex records.
